Faith Groups Urge Senate to Consider SCOTUS Nominee

“The democratic process is fundamental to the American way of life and to our Unitarian Universalist faith community, but it only works if elected leaders fulfill their duties. It is time to put partisan politicking aside and to fill the Supreme Court vacancy. I strongly urge the senators blocking this process to do their moral and ethical duty and hold hearings for Judge Merrick Garland,” said UUA President Peter Morales. The letter was signed by ten faith-based organizations who agree that the Senate must do its job as mandated by the Constitution.
